IPA: /ˈsiːkwəl/
KK: /ˈsiːkwəl/
A work, such as a book or movie, that continues the story of a previous work.
The sequel to the popular movie was even more exciting than the first one.
Sequel → It is derived from the Latin word "sequela" (meaning a following or a consequence). The word "sequel" refers to something that follows, particularly in a series or narrative.
